Computes the signature for the specified hash value using the specified padding.
public:
override cli::array <System::Byte> ^ SignHash(cli::array <System::Byte> ^ hash, System::Security::Cryptography::HashAlgorithmName hashAlgorithm, System::Security::Cryptography::RSASignaturePadding ^ padding);
public override byte[] SignHash (byte[] hash, System.Security.Cryptography.HashAlgorithmName hashAlgorithm, System.Security.Cryptography.RSASignaturePadding padding);
override this.SignHash : byte[] * System.Security.Cryptography.HashAlgorithmName * System.Security.Cryptography.RSASignaturePadding -> byte[]
Public Overrides Function SignHash (hash As Byte(), hashAlgorithm As HashAlgorithmName, padding As RSASignaturePadding) As Byte()
Parameters
- hash
- Byte[]
The hash value of the data to be signed.
- hashAlgorithm
- HashAlgorithmName
The hash algorithm used to create the hash value of the data.
- padding
- RSASignaturePadding
The padding.
Returns
The RSA signature for the specified hash value.
